Ethereum (ETH): Battling the $2,400 Resistance
Ethereum, the second-larg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ization, closed the week in negative territory, experiencing a 3% decline. This downturn occurred as sellers re-emerged at the crucial $2,400 resistance level, a price point that has proven to be a formidable barrier in recent trading sessions. The market is closely watching whether this weekly close will form a bearish engulfing candle pattern on the price chart, which could signal a more significant trend reversal and a deeper correction.
The current stall in bullish momentum suggests that Ethereum may be consolidating its position, potentially gathering strength for another assault on the $2,400 resistance in the coming month of May. If this pullback proves to be a temporary pause rather than a fundamental shift in market sentiment, the cryptocurrency could see renewed upward movement.

For Ethereum to initiate a sustained rally, a decisive break above the $2,400 mark is imperative. Should this level transition from resistance to support, it would pave the way for potential upward movement towards the $2,800 target. Conversely, another failure to breach this resistance could embolden bearish forces, leading to a retest of the $2,000 support level.
The broader context for Ethereum’s price action is influenced by ongoing developments within its ecosystem. The successful implementation of upgrades, such as the Dencun upgrade which introduced proto-Danksharding, has aimed to reduce transaction fees on layer-2 scaling solutions. However, market sentiment and macroeconomic factors continue to play a significant role in its price performance. The current consolidation above $2,000 indicates a battle between buyers and sellers, with the $2,400 level serving as the immediate battleground.
Ripple (XRP): Navigating a Pennant Formation Amidst Range-Bound Trading
Ripple’s XRP experienced a more pronounced downturn, closing the week down 5%, after failing to sustain its price above the $1.40 mark. This price action has led XRP into a large pennant formation, a chart pattern that often precedes a significant price movement. Analysts anticipate a breakout from this pattern before mid-May. The prevailing sentiment suggests that this pennant, occurring within the current market environment, could signal a continuation of the pre-existing bearish trend.
The immediate focus for XRP buyers is to consolidate their position and reclaim $1.40 as a support level. Failure to achieve this would grant sellers greater leverage, potentially driving the price to new lower lows and resuming the established downtrend.
Since February, XRP has been trading within a defined range, fluctuating between $1.60 and $1.30. This period of consolidation has been characterized by a lack of strong directional momentum. However, recent market dynamics indicate that sellers may be gaining a stronger foothold. If this trend persists, XRP could descend to new lows, with $1.00 identified as a key psychological and technical support level.
The regulatory landscape surrounding Ripple continues to be a significant factor influencing XRP’s price. The ongoing legal battle with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) has created a degree of uncertainty, impacting investor confidence. While there have been favorable rulings for Ripple in certain aspects of the case, the overall resolution remains a key determinant of its future price trajectory. The current pennant formation suggests that the market is awaiting a decisive catalyst, be it regulatory news or broader market sentiment, to break the existing trading range.
Cardano (ADA): Struggling to Break Key Support at $0.24
Cardano (ADA) is also facing headwinds, having closed the week with a modest 2% loss. While the percentage decline is relatively small, the more concerning aspect for ADA investors is the cryptocurrency’s persistent inability to break above the crucial $0.24 support level. This level has acted as a floor, but the sustained inability of buyers to push the price higher increases the likelihood of a bearish breach.
The longer ADA remains stagnant below this key resistance, the greater the chance that sellers will mount a renewed assault on the $0.24 level, potentially leading to a breakdown and a move into lower lows.
Since the start of 2026, Cardano has been trading in a flat pattern, failing to establish higher highs. The current momentum appears to be tilted towards the bearish side, suggesting that ADA might need to experience a further price decline before a significant buyer resurgence occurs. This scenario could see the price dip below $0.24, with $0.20 emerging as a key target for potential support.
Cardano’s development roadmap, particularly its focus on scalability and sustainability through its proof-of-stake consensus mechanism, continues to be a long-term bullish narrative. However, in the short to medium term, broader market sentiment and the performance of major c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um often dictate ADA’s price action. The current struggle at $0.24 highlights the need for a stronger influx of buying pressure or a shift in overall market sentiment to reignite bullish momentum.
Binance Coin (BNB): Consolidating Above $580 Amidst Weakening Volume
Binance Coin (BNB) has been exhibiting a pattern of consolidation, hovering near the key $580 support level without exhibiting significant upward momentum. This lack of bullish activity has allowed sellers to gain the upper hand, resulting in a 3% loss for the week. Further exacerbating the bearish sentiment is the apparent absence of strong buyer interest, a trend reflected in the declining volume profile, which indicates waning trading conviction.
BNB has maintained a relatively flat trading range above $580 since early February. An attempt to break through the $690 resistance was met with swift selling pressure, capping the upward movement.
Looking ahead, Binance Coin appears to be in a period of price action pause, which could be accumulating energy for an eventual breakout. However, the current market dynamics suggest that sellers currently hold a more advantageous position. If they succeed in pushing the price lower, their next significant target is anticipated to be at the $500 level.
The performance of Binance Coin is intrinsically linked to the broader ecosystem of the Binance exchange, including its associated blockchain and decentralized applications. Developments within the Binance ecosystem, regulatory scrutiny, and the overall health of the cryptocurrency market all play a role in BNB’s price. The current consolidation above $580 suggests a period of indecision, with the market awaiting a catalyst to determine the next directional move. The weakening volume indicates that a significant portion of market participants are on the sidelines, waiting for clearer signals.
Hyperliquid (HYPE): Bearish Wedge Breakout Signals Potential Downturn
Hyperliquid (HYPE) is currently facing significant headwinds following a decisive break below a bearish wedge pattern. This pattern is notably similar to a formation observed in late 2025, which preceded a sustained correction that saw HYPE shed over 64% of its valuation.
Should history repeat itself, HYPE could experience a substantial decline, potentially falling below the $20 mark in the future. While this outcome remains uncertain, the immediate price action is bearish, with the cryptocurrency closing the week down 2%. However, the concurrently falling volume suggests that the conviction behind the current bearish move may be weak, potentially indicating a less severe correction than the previous one.
Looking ahead, the current price action makes it unlikely for HYPE to achieve new significant highs in the near term. Nevertheless, the cryptocurrency may find strong support at the $36 or $30 levels. These price points could potentially attract buyers back into the market, offering a reprieve from any renewed downward pressure.
The performance of Hyperliquid, a decentralized perpetual futures exchange built on the Arbitrum network, is influenced by the growth and adoption of decentralized finance (DeFi) protocols, as well as the overall sentiment within the derivatives trading space. The break below the bearish wedge signals a potential shift in momentum, but the weak volume suggests that the market is not yet fully committed to a significant sell-off. The upcoming price action will be crucial in determining whether this is a brief correction or the beginning of a more prolonged downturn.
